Calendar calendar = Calendar.getInstance();
calendar.set(Calendar.MONTH, 1);
SimpleDateFormat simpleDateFormat = new SimpleDateFormat("MMM");
simpleDateFormat.setCalendar(calendar);
String monthName = simpleDateFormat.format(calendar.getTime());
Log.d("monthName: ", monthName);
在这段代码中,我试图根据它的数字得到一个月的名字。在此示例中,我想记录二月份的数字,但在此示例中,它会记录Mar
而不是Feb
。
为什么这不起作用? Feb
的索引是1,不是吗?